Video conferencing is an inexpensive alternative to the physical in -person meeting. It connects people, places, and processes at a fraction of a cost without the inconvenience of business travel. By allowing companies to avoid some of their business trips, video conferencing can generate considerable savings on airfare, hotel and meal costs, ground transportation and entertainment expenses. Furthermore, since video conferencing does not require physical attendance, meetings can be automatically set which in turn speeds up the decision making process. Video conference is also an instantaneous solution for time-consuming support and knowledge sharing concerns. With business process outsourcing becoming a trend on multinational companies, migrating process can be done through video conferencing instead of flying in the person for face-to-face sessions.

A lot of companies that offer video conferencing these days eliminate the general concerns in using video conference i.e. cost, bandwidth availability and lack of technical resources. This means that even the smallest of organisation can afford to avail video conferencing. Aside from meetings, organisations also use video conference in conducting trainings, data sharing, recruitment and the likes.
